Forestry Clearing in Atlanta, GA
Forestry clearing services involve the removal of trees, brush, and other vegetation to create open, accessible areas on residential properties. These services are often used for projects such as preparing land for new construction, creating firebreaks, managing overgrown landscapes, or clearing space for recreational activities.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of clearing involved, the types of machinery used, and how the process affects the land’s future use. Clarifying these details helps ensure the project aligns with the property’s needs and any local regulations.
Before requesting forestry clearing, property owners should consider the size and density of the area to be cleared, as well as any specific goals for the land afterward. It’s also helpful to know if there are any protected trees or environmental restrictions in the area. Understanding these factors can assist in planning the project effectively and ensuring the clearing process meets both safety standards and land management objectives.

Common Forestry Clearing Jobs
Tree and brush removal - clearing overgrown areas to improve property safety and appearance.
Stump grinding - removing leftover stumps to prevent regrowth and create level ground.
Selective clearing - removing specific trees or vegetation to enhance landscaping or access.
Lot thinning - reducing density of trees to promote healthier growth and reduce fire risk.
Hazardous tree removal - taking out damaged or unstable trees to prevent property damage.
Underbrush clearing - removing dense undergrowth to improve visibility and reduce pests.
Forestry Clearing Questions
What is forestry clearing? Forestry clearing involves removing trees and brush to prepare land for development, agriculture, or landscaping projects.
What types of projects require forestry clearing? Projects such as building construction, land development, trail creation, and property renovation often need forestry clearing services.
Is forestry clearing suitable for all property sizes? Forestry clearing can be performed on properties of various sizes, from small lots to large parcels of land.
What should property owners consider before forestry clearing? It's important to assess the land's topography, vegetation type, and future land use plans before beginning forestry clearing.
